How Progressive Blackjack Works
The base game of Progressive Jackpot Blackjack follows the standard rules you know: beat the dealer without exceeding 21. However, the “Progressive” element is an optional side bet that you must place at the start of each hand.
- The Side Bet: Usually a fixed amount (typically $1 or $5), this bet is placed in a special “jackpot” circle on the table.
- The Pot: A portion of every side bet placed by players across the network is added to a central prize pool.
- The Trigger: You win the jackpot (or a portion of it) if you are dealt a specific combination of cards, regardless of whether you win or lose the actual blackjack hand.
Winning Combinations and Payouts
The “Super 4” and “Triple 7s” are the most common progressive jackpot systems found at the Canadian sites we review. While payouts vary by software provider (like Evolution or Playtech), a typical 2026 paytable looks like this:
| Card Combination | Typical Payout |
| Four Suited Aces | 100% of the Progressive Jackpot |
| Three Suited Aces | 10% of the Jackpot or Fixed $5,000 |
| Four Aces (Any Suit) | Fixed $2,500 |
| Three Aces (Any Suit) | Fixed $250 |
| Two Aces | Fixed $50 |
In some “Super 4” variants, the jackpot is triggered based on a combination of your two cards and the dealer’s two cards (forming a four-card hand). A Royal Flush in Diamonds across these four cards often triggers the 100% “Mega” jackpot.

Strategy for Progressive Jackpot Players
Because the jackpot is tied to a side bet, your strategy for the main game remains the same: always follow Basic Strategy. However, managing the side bet requires its own tactical approach.
1. Evaluate the “Seed” and the “Ceiling”
Every progressive jackpot has a starting “seed” (e.g., $10,000). At Winner Online, we recommend looking for jackpots that have grown significantly past their seed. The higher the jackpot, the more “value” your $1 side bet has in terms of mathematical probability.
2. Budget for the Side Bet
The jackpot side bet has a much higher house edge than the main game. If you are a “jackpot hunter,” ensure your bankroll can handle the consistent $1 or $5 drain. Many pros only place the side bet when the jackpot reaches a certain “break-even” point.
3. Check the Rules for “Split” Hands
In most progressive games, if you split a pair of Aces, only the first Ace counts toward the jackpot combination. Always read the table rules on our featured sites to ensure you don’t accidentally disqualify yourself from a big win.
